Market Overview
Cryogenic tanks are specialized storage containers designed
to hold gases at temperatures typically lower than -150°C (-238°F). The
cryogenic tank market in Australia is fueled by the increasing demand for gases
like oxygen and nitrogen in sectors such as healthcare, oil and gas, food
processing, and aerospace. Cryogenic tanks come in various sizes and
configurations, from small-scale tanks used in hospitals for oxygen storage to
large tanks utilized in the liquefied natural gas (LNG) sector. As Australia's
industrial sector continues to evolve, the demand for cryogenic tanks is
expected to rise accordingly.
The healthcare industry is one of the key drivers of the cryogenic
tank market. Hospitals and medical facilities across Australia rely on
cryogenic tanks to store medical oxygen, which is critical in treating patients
with respiratory conditions. Additionally, cryogenic tanks are used in medical
research for the preservation of biological samples and the storage of liquid
nitrogen. The growth of healthcare infrastructure in the country, combined with
advancements in medical technology, is likely to continue boosting demand for
cryogenic storage solutions.
Another important factor contributing to the market's growth
is the rise of the LNG industry in Australia. The country is one of the largest
exporters of LNG globally, and the infrastructure required to store and
transport this energy resource is expanding rapidly. Cryogenic tanks are
indispensable for storing LNG at low temperatures, making them integral to the
LNG supply chain. As Australia continues to capitalize on its natural gas
reserves, the cryogenic tank market is poised for significant growth, particularly
in the energy sector.
Key Market Drivers
Energy Demand and LNG Export Growth: Australia has
seen a surge in demand for natural gas, particularly from countries like China,
Japan, and South Korea. As a result, the nation has invested heavily in LNG
infrastructure. Cryogenic tanks play a critical role in the liquefaction and
storage of natural gas, enabling its safe transport over long distances. With
Australia poised to become one of the world’s top LNG exporters, the cryogenic
tank market is expected to benefit from ongoing investments in LNG facilities
and infrastructure.
Healthcare Sector Growth: The Australian healthcare
industry has been growing steadily, with an increased focus on respiratory care
and the preservation of biological samples. The need for medical-grade
cryogenic tanks for oxygen storage and liquid nitrogen preservation is on the
rise, especially as the country's aging population increases. With hospitals
and research institutions expanding, the demand for cryogenic tanks in the
healthcare sector is expected to continue its upward trajectory.
Food and Beverage Industry: The food and beverage
industry in Australia is also a significant consumer of cryogenic tanks. These
tanks are used in various food processing applications, such as freezing,
refrigeration, and packaging. The increasing demand for frozen foods, combined
with the trend of using cryogenic freezing techniques for preserving food
products, contributes to the expansion of the cryogenic tank market in the
country.
Aerospace Industry: Cryogenic tanks are integral to
the aerospace sector, particularly in the storage of fuel for spacecraft and
rockets. With Australia's growing involvement in space exploration and
satellite launches, there is a rising demand for cryogenic storage systems that
can withstand the extreme conditions required in space missions. This trend
further supports the demand for cryogenic tanks in the country.
Challenges Facing the Market
Despite the promising growth prospects, the Australia
Cryogenic Tank Market faces several challenges that could impact its expansion.
High Initial Investment: Cryogenic tanks,
particularly those used in industrial applications like LNG storage, involve
substantial initial capital investment. This includes the cost of the tanks
themselves, as well as the associated infrastructure needed to operate and
maintain these systems. Small and medium-sized enterprises (SMEs) may find it
difficult to afford the high upfront costs, which could limit market growth in
certain sectors.
Regulatory and Safety Standards: Cryogenic tanks are
subject to strict safety regulations due to the hazardous nature of the gases
they store. For instance, LNG storage tanks need to be designed and maintained
to prevent leaks or explosions. Compliance with these regulations requires significant
investment in technology and safety systems, which could pose a challenge for
market participants, particularly smaller manufacturers or operators.
Technological Complexity: Cryogenic storage systems
are technologically advanced and require specialized knowledge to operate
efficiently. The complexity of designing, manufacturing, and maintaining
cryogenic tanks means that there is a limited pool of experts capable of ensuring
the safe and efficient operation of these systems. This could result in
operational challenges, including maintenance costs, breakdowns, and delays in
supply chain operations.
Environmental Concerns: While cryogenic storage is
essential for certain industrial processes, there are concerns about the
environmental impact of storing and transporting large volumes of liquefied
gases. There is increasing pressure on industries to adopt more sustainable practices,
including reducing carbon emissions from cryogenic storage facilities. This may
lead to higher costs for companies investing in cryogenic tanks and storage
infrastructure.
